Skip to main content
Log in

Klassische Runge-Kutta-Formeln fünfter und siebenter Ordnung mit Schrittweiten-Kontrolle

Classical fifth- and seventh-order Runge-Kutta formulas with stepsize control

  • Published:
Computing Aims and scope Submit manuscript

Zusammenfassung

Es werden neue, expliziteRunge-Kutta-Formeln fünfter und siebenter Ordnung hergeleitet. Diese Formeln enthalten eine Schrittweiten-Kontrolle, die auf einer vollständigen Erfassung des ersten Gliedes des lokalen Abbruchfehlers basiert. Die Formeln erfordern-pro Integrationsschritt-weniger Auswertungen der Differentialgleichungen als andereRunge-Kutta-Formeln entsprechender Ordnung, wenn bei letzteren ebenfalls eine Schrittweiten-Kontrolle (Richardson's extrapolation to the limit) verwendet wird. Durch geeignete Wahl einiger Parameter kann in unseren Formeln das erste Glied des Abbruchfehlers stark reduziert werden; dadurch wird eine Vergrößerung der Schrittweite-ohne Verlust an Genauigkeit-ermöglicht. Ein numerisches Beispiel wird gebracht. Bei gleicher Genauigkeit ergeben unsere Formeln in diesem Beispiel 40% bis 60% Ersparnis an Rechenzeit, verglichen mit den bekanntenRunge-Kutta-Formeln gleicher Ordnung.

Summary

New explicit fifth- and seventh-orderRunge-Kutta formulas are derived. They include a stepsize control procedure based on a complete coverage of the leading term of the local truncation error. These formulas require fewer evaluations per step than otherRunge-Kutta formulas of corresponding order if the latter ones are also used with stepsize control (richardson's extrapolation to the limit). By a proper choice of some parameters the leading truncation error term of our formulas can be reduced substantially, thereby allowing an increase in the stepsize without loss of accuracy. A numerical example is presented. Our results being of the same accuracy, we save in this example 40% to 60% computer time compared with the knownRunge-Kutta formulas of corresponding order.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Literatur

  1. Butcher, J. C.: Coefficients for the Study ofRunge-Kutta Integration Processes. J. Austral. Math. Soc.3, 185–201 (1963).

    Google Scholar 

  2. Butcher, J. C.: OnRunge-Kutta Processes of High Order. J. Austral. Math. Soc.4, 179–194 (1964).

    Google Scholar 

  3. Fehlberg, E.: Eine Methode zur Fehlerverkleinerung beimRunge-Kutta-Verfahren. Z. angew. Math. Mech.38, 421–426 (1958).

    Google Scholar 

  4. Fehlberg, E.: New High-OrderRunge-Kutta Formulas with Stepsize Control for Systems of First- and Second-Order Differential Equations. Z. angew. Math. Mech.44, Sonderheft, T17-T29 (1964).

    Google Scholar 

  5. Fehlberg, E.: New High-OrderRunge-Kutta Formulas with an Arbitrarily Small Truncation Error. Z. angew. Math. Mech.46, 1–16 (1966).

    Google Scholar 

  6. Fehlberg, E.: Classical Fifth-, Sixth-, Seventh-, and Eighth-OrderRunge-Kutta Formulas with Stepsize Control. NASA Technical Report 287,1968.

  7. Huta, A.: Une amélioration de la méthode deRunge-Kutta-Nyström pour la résolution numérique des équations différentielles du premier ordre. Acta Fac. Nat. Univ. Comenian. Math.1, 201–224 (1956).

    Google Scholar 

  8. Huta, A.: Contribution à la formule de sixième ordre dans la méthode deRunge-Kutta-Nyström. Acta Fac. Nat. Univ. Comenian. Math.2, 21–24 (1967).

    Google Scholar 

  9. Kutta, W.: Beitrag zur näherungsweisen Integration totaler Differentialgleichungen. Z. Math. Phys.46, 435–453 (1901).

    Google Scholar 

  10. Nyström, E. J.: Über die numerische Integration von Differentialgleichungen. Acta Soc. Sci. Fenn.50, Nr. 13 (1925).

  11. Shanks, E. B.: Solutions of Differential Equations by Evaluations of Functions. Math. Comp.20, 21–38 (1966).

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Additional information

Dies ist ein stark gekürzter Auszug eines vom Autor herausgebrachten, internen NASA Technical Report [6], auf den hinsichtlich vieler Einzelheiten und hinsichtlich der Formeln sechster und achter Ordnung verweisen sei.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Fehlberg, E. Klassische Runge-Kutta-Formeln fünfter und siebenter Ordnung mit Schrittweiten-Kontrolle. Computing 4, 93–106 (1969). https://doi.org/10.1007/BF02234758

Download citation

  • Received:

  • Issue Date:

  • DOI: https://doi.org/10.1007/BF02234758

Navigation